Spring is a good time to clear your space of excess items … things that you no longer use or love. Clutter holds you back and stops you in your tracks. It’s easy for it to accumulate without ongoing vigilance. More importantly, a lot of clutter can be a sign of self-sabotage that prevents you from living your life to the fullest. You put off doing things that bring you joy because you’re overwhelmed by your “stuff,” and you
avoid thinning things out because you never get around to it. This article from the New Yorker might interest you.
